Understanding Knee Replacement Surgery
Knee substitute surgery, also known as total knee arthroplasty , is a frequent procedure to ease suffering and regain movement in individuals experiencing severe arthritis . During this surgical procedure, the worn knee joint of the knee are removed and replaced with prosthetic components, typically made of ceramics and plastic . This permits patients to return to a more active lifestyle, often with significant relief from long-term knee problems. The objective is to provide pain relief and improved function, though it’s important to understand the possible risks and healing timeline involved.

Joint Replacement Options : Considering Conservative Solutions
Before opting for knee replacement, individuals should explore various non-surgical therapies . These options may include targeted treatment , pain relief to reduce discomfort , infusions such as cortisone or viscosupplementation substances, and activity changes. Frequently , these strategies can give substantial improvement and delay the requirement for major procedure .
